Just earlier today I signed up for the Editor Program and was recently approved. And I just got my first request for an edit! This request was sent to me from the Literotica Editor Program <noreply@literotica.com> and the email contained the requester's message. However, the email also instructed: "If you would like to work with this user, please email them directly." However, in the portion of the email that lists the writers "Email Address:", it just shows their usename again. No @whatever.com. So, I'm uncertain as how to proceed. Did I miss something here? Or is it possible that the writer never included an email address as part of their profile and therefore it's not possible to email them? I thought about messaging them through the forums (since I know their username) but I have participated in the Editor program before as a writer and the Editor always replied to my request with an email. What gives?

You can’t reply direct to the mail, it gets lost. There are two options, try sending a PM to the user through the forum, but be aware many writers don’t belong in the forum, they just use the story side.

The alternative is to click on the link in the email after “User's Literotica Member Page:” and send a message there asking for their email.

When sending a message using the Lit profile, you don’t have to enter a reply email. Obviously if you want a reply, then it is needed, but not everyone realises that.
